ICC World Test Championship final: India announces playing XI against New Zealand

India would be taking on New Zealand in the ICC World Test Championship 2019-21 final at the Rose Bowl in Southampton from Friday. India named the playing XI for the game on Thursday. Check out who all feature in it.

Team India is all set to take on the New Zealand challenge on Friday in the 2019-21 ICC World Test Championship final at the Rose Bowl in Southampton. It is the maiden edition of the global Test tournament, as the winner would be crowned the king of Test cricket.

Ahead of the all-important clash, the Indian team announced its playing XI on Thursday. Led by Virat Kohli, Rohit Sharma and Shubman Gill would be the openers. At number three, it would be Cheteshwar Pujara, while Kohli is likely to come in at number four. They would be followed by vice-captain Ajinkya Rahane at five, while wicketkeeper-batsman Rishabh Pant should bat at number six.

At number seven would be all-rounder Ravindra Jadeja, followed by fellow veteran all-rounder Ravichandran Ashwin at number seven. Interestingly, the side has decided to move in with two spinners, despite the possibility of a green track.

As for the proper bowling attack, the side has three specialist spinners in the form of Jasprit Bumrah, Ishant Sharma and Mohammed Shami. Also, with overcast conditions being predicted throughout the playing days, it would be interesting to see how the seamers fare. From the 15-member squad announced on Wednesday, Wriddhiman Saha, Umesh Yadav and Mohammed Siraj fail to make the cut.

India XI for WTC final: Virat Kohli (c), Rohit Sharma, Shubman Gill, Cheteshwar Pujara, Ajinkya Rahane, Rishabh Pant (wk), Ravindra Jadeja, R Ashwin, Ishant Sharma, Mohammed Shami and Jasprit Bumrah.
